Staff at the Heartland Mall Laidoff

By: BCH Staff
Updated: February 5, 2013
Big Country Homepage staff has learned that the administrative staff at the Heartland Mall in Brownwood has been removed.

We currently do not know the reason behind the changes. Our crew in Brownwood spoke with several people who believe that the mall ownership simply wanted a change in management. However, there is also speculation that the property may have been sold.

Business owners and customers in the mall were asked not to make any comments to the media.

Owners of some of the stores were apparently concerned about the future of the mall itself.

 We will have more information as soon as it becomes available.
